Knockout?
Ron | Jersey | 04/04/2008
(4 out of 5 stars)

"The funny thing about naming a card Knockout is that it produced no knockouts the entire night. Mostly decisions and a few subs. The undercard fights actually produced a few nice submissions. The main cards were a little underwhelming. What saves this card and raises it sky high is the Shogun/Forrest Griffin fight. Not since the first Tyson/Holyfield fight have I found myself jumping out of my seat during a match. That one I can watch over and over."
